#1334d1 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1334d1 is composed of 7.5% red, 20.4% green and 82%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 90.9% cyan, 75.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 229.6 degrees, a saturation of 83.3% and a lightness of 44.7%. #1334d1 color hex could be obtained by blending #2668ff with #0000a3. Closest websafe color is: #0033cc.

#1334d1 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1334d1 has RGB values of R:19, G:52, B:209 and CMYK values of C:0.91, M:0.75, Y:0,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 1258705.
